A driver was injured in a crash Thursday afternoon when he mounted a median and knocked down a tree, said Fort Collins Police Public Information Officer Kate Kimble.
The driver was transported to Poudre Valley Hospital with injuries. The crash occurred just south of the intersection at Laurel Street and College Avenue around 4:45 p.m. Thursday.

Police and a tree clean-up crew left the area around 6 p.m. with traffic flowing normally.
